-
Graphql Input Validation, Contribute to bbakerman/graphql-java-extended-validation development by creating an account on GitHub. Suppose that I have this schema : interface FoodType Is there a possibility to create a GraphQL input with a mandatory input or another. validate(schema: GraphQLSchema, document_ast: In conclusion, implementing data validation and input sanitization in GraphQL APIs is essential for ensuring the integrity and security of the data being sent and received. A request must be Learn how to validate GraphQL schema with this step-by-step guide, improving data consistency and security. This can be used to easily validate input Implementing input sanitization in GraphQL APIs involves defining strict input types, validating user-controlled variables, sanitizing query output, and implementing rate limiting Implementing input sanitization involves validating user input, sanitizing output, implementing rate limiting and request throttling, and staying up to date with security best practices. The tool expects valid Schema input — submitting data in the wrong format produces confusing errors. GraphQL will also checks whether the fields Async-graphql Book Input value validators Async-graphql has some common validators built-in, you can use them on the parameters of object fields or on the fields of InputObject. EntityGraphQL provides a couple of ways to Validation: By defining input types, GraphQL helps in validating the data sent to the server. validation package fulfills the Validation phase of fulfilling a GraphQL result. You Validation runs synchronously, returning a list of encountered errors, or an empty list if no errors were encountered and the document is valid. faid 4wyhq z1m7 gfic4 zep 4en btqen oqij4i dwkqxr ykn